What is Beeper?

Beeper is a universal messaging app that brings all of your chat networks together into a single, unified inbox — letting you send and receive messages from services like WhatsApp, iMessage, Signal, Telegram, Instagram, Messenger and many more, all in one place. It addresses a frustration almost everyone shares: conversations scattered across a dozen different messaging apps, forcing you to constantly switch between them and keep track of where each conversation lives. Beeper consolidates that chaos into one clean interface.

The appeal is simple but powerful. Instead of bouncing between many apps to keep up with friends, family and colleagues who each prefer different platforms, you manage all your conversations in Beeper, with a unified inbox, search across all your messages, and a consistent experience regardless of the underlying network. This saves time, reduces the mental overhead of fragmented communication, and makes it far easier to stay on top of everyone you talk to. It works across desktop and mobile, keeping your conversations in sync wherever you are.

What is Loom?

Loom is an async video messaging tool that lets you record your screen and camera in seconds and share the result as a link anyone can watch on their own time. It was built around a simple insight about modern work: an enormous number of meetings and long back-and-forth message threads exist only because something is easier to show than to type. Loom replaces those with a quick recorded video — you talk through the screen, point at what matters, and send a link — capturing tone, context, and visual detail that text loses, without forcing everyone onto a call at the same moment.

The magic is in the speed and the receiving experience. Recording is one click; when you stop, the video is instantly processed and the shareable link is already on your clipboard. Viewers can watch at their own pace, speed it up, comment at specific timestamps, and react — turning a monologue into a lightweight conversation. Loom automatically transcribes videos and can generate summaries and chapters, so recipients can skim or jump to the part they need. For teams, it integrates with the tools where work already happens, so a Loom can live inside a ticket, a doc, a pull request, or a message thread.

Loom is a favourite of remote and distributed teams, but its uses are everywhere: walking a colleague through a bug, giving design feedback, onboarding a new hire, recording a product demo, answering a customer's question, or explaining a process once instead of repeating it ten times. The deeper payoff is cultural — it lets teams shift from synchronous, calendar-clogging communication to thoughtful async updates, reclaiming focus time and respecting people across time zones.
